Definition
An infected abortion occurs when an infection develops in the material from the fetus or placenta or the lining of the uterus (endometrium). See also:

Causes, incidence, and risk factors
An infected abortion may occur if parts of the fetal or placental tissue stay in the uterus after an incomplete abortion.
